Pete Whittaker and Tom Randall break the Staffs Nose record by 2 hours 14 minutes!, 5 kbTom Randall and Pete Whittaker - AKA The Wideboyz - have established the world's biggest roof crack at White Rim in Utah's Canyonlands National Park, USA. Crown of Thorns 5.14a features 165ft of horizontal climbing.

Would also like to know what an 'Invert Torpedo' is.

Also is a knee lock different to a knee bar? (if so how?)

Anyway cracking effort to the pair of them!
 Steve Long 04 Oct 2016
In reply to SuperLee1985:

Knee bar = foot to knee lever between surfaces. Knee lock = just the knee in the crack. That's my understanding anyway!
cb294 04 Oct 2016
In reply to Steve Long:

I always assumed the difference was in how the jamming action is generated: Knee bar -> sideways rotation at the hip, Knee lock -> lateral expansion due to bending of the knee. I love offwidth climbing, and am always amused when people think it is only grunting and pain (there is that too) and no technique.

No idea what an invert torpedo (or a standard torpedo at that) is supposed to be. Full body jamming, head up or down?
